PAID 2YR CONTRACT UPFRONT & NO SERVICE

Good day,<br> <br> My aunt had taken out a Cell C 24 month Cell C mobile contract, i.e. :-<br> <br> - Samsung Galaxy Note 4<br> - Smart Chat 1 Gig Postpaid<br> - Inception - 12 June 2015<br> - Monthly payment - R549.00<br> <br> In July 2015 my aunt was having financial issues and could not afford the contract. I then decided to take it over from her, i.e. as a private agreement between my aunt and I. I paid the monthly subs until December 2015 but I was not receiving the monthly data and talk minutes. <br> <br> In Jan 2016 I spoke to the Cell C manager at Cell C, Victoria Rd, Pmb and advised him that I want to pay off the full 24 month contract but will still want to receive the monthly data and talk time. He confirmed that if I paid up the contract I will indeed still receive the monthly data and talk time.<br> <br> On 15 Jan 2016, I paid R10,814.62 as per Cell C's settlement letter.<br> <br> Since Aug 2015 to date I have not been receiving the monthly service. I have sent several emails to Cell C but do not get a positive response.<br> <br> <br> <br> <br>
